美文网首页
Centos7.3 + Python3.6

Centos7.3 + Python3.6

作者: Eetu | 来源:发表于2017-08-27 13:34 被阅读0次

    安装依赖

    # yum install openssl-devel bzip2-devel expat-devel gdbm-devel readline-devel sqlite-devel gcc
    

    安装Python3.6.2

    # wget https://www.python.org/ftp/python/3.6.2/Python-3.6.2.tgz
    # tar -xzvf Python-3.6.2.tgz -C /tmp
    # cd  /tmp/Python-3.6.2/
    

    把Python3.6安装到 /usr/local 目录

    # ./configure --prefix=/usr/local
    # make
    # make altinstall
    

    更改/usr/bin/python链接

    # cd /usr/bin
    # mv  python python.backup
    # ln -s /usr/local/bin/python3.6 /usr/bin/python
    # ln -s /usr/local/bin/python3.6 /usr/bin/python3
    

    更改yum脚本的python依赖

    # cd /usr/bin
    # ls yum*
    yum yum-config-manager yum-debug-restore yum-groups-manager yum-builddep yum-debug-dump yumdownloader
    更改以上文件头为:
    #!/usr/bin/python 改为 #!/usr/bin/python2
    

    修改gnome-tweak-tool配置文件

    # vi /usr/bin/gnome-tweak-tool
    #!/usr/bin/python 改为 #!/usr/bin/python2
    

    修改urlgrabber配置文件

    # vi /usr/libexec/urlgrabber-ext-down
    #!/usr/bin/python 改为 #!/usr/bin/python2
    

    安装pip

    查看/usr/local/bin/目录,我们发现安装python3.6时已经同时安装好了pip


    这里做个软链方便使用

    # ln -s /usr/local/bin/pip3.6 /usr/local/bin/pip3
    # ln -s /usr/local/bin/pip3.6 /usr/local/bin/pip
    

    参考http://www.jianshu.com/p/325f16755680

    相关文章

      网友评论

          本文标题:Centos7.3 + Python3.6

          本文链接:https://www.haomeiwen.com/subject/xcxmdxtx.html